Love is Caring

I've been told I love too fast

That I love like I loved the last

You haven't known me long enough

Just go back to acting tough

 

But they don't understand what I mean

This "love" word isn't all it seems

It just means that I care a lot

That, for you, I would take a shot

That you can call me when you're sad

Or scream and rant when you get mad

If you get lonely, I'll hold your hand

I'll pull you out of that sinking sand

 

We may break up, and our paths part

But you will always be in my heart

I hope you are deliriously happy

Because you deserve it

With or without me
